WebHere's a quick preview of the steps we're about to follow: Step 1: Find the mean. Step 2: For each data point, find the square of its distance to the mean. Step 3: Sum the values from Step 2. Step 4: Divide by the number of data points. Step 5: Take the square root. WebApr 10, 2024 · Mean = Sum of Observations/Total number of observations The other two statistical methods used are median and mode to obtain a result for a given set of data. The median is defined as the value present in the middle of a given set of data and the mode is the frequency with which a particular number occurs in a given set of data.

The mean formula is defined as the sum of the observations divided by the total number of observations.
